To what extent did the results of WW1 determine the outbreak of another, big war ~20 years later?
MAIN BODY:
1) Germany
? felt embittered & humiliated
? harsh peace treaty:
? lost Alsace-Lorraine, Polish corridor, Gdansk (free city), colonies
? occupation of Rhineland
? forced disarmament, army significantly diminished
? war indemnities – 6,600 mln pounds
